Polaris Inc. is an American automotive manufacturer headquartered in Medina, Minnesota, United States. Polaris was founded in Roseau, Minnesota, where it still has engineering and manufacturing facilities. The company manufactured motorcycles through its Victory Motorcycles subsidiary until January 2017, then produced motorcycles through the Indian Motorcycle subsidiary, which it purchased in April 2011 and announced its divestiture in October 2025. Somnigroup International Inc. is an American manufacturer of mattresses and bedding products.
